Output 33999fd7a1ec643070d7fb00d30650f3c24fe0acb00e6f90083ec8676885d8aa:41

value
118146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571649ec47bfb608ac547a8b22edc939857e8798 OP_EQUAL
address
39dVQtBhFxE4WPCLQpSbA5PstDNYp61fsx
transaction
33999fd7a1ec643070d7fb00d30650f3c24fe0acb00e6f90083ec8676885d8aa
spent
true